Is The Sims 4 an online game?

Is The Sims 4 an Online Game?

The Sims 4 is a popular life simulation video game developed by Maxis and published by Electronic Arts (EA). Since its release in 2014, the game has received numerous updates, expansions, and patches. With its vast online community and regular updates, many players wonder if The Sims 4 is an online game. In this article, we’ll explore the answer to this question and delve into the game’s online features.

Direct Answer: Is The Sims 4 an Online Game?

The Sims 4 is not a traditional online game in the sense that it doesn’t require a constant internet connection to play. However, it does offer some online features that allow players to interact with each other and share content. The game can be played offline, but to access these online features, a player must have an active internet connection.
